The Witch of Endor is a character mentioned in the Hebrew Bible in the First Book of Samuel. She is also known as the Medium of Endor. According to the biblical account, King Saul of Israel consulted the Witch of Endor to summon the spirit of the deceased prophet Samuel for advice. In the story, Saul was desperate for guidance as he prepared to go into battle against the Philistines. However, God had stopped speaking to Saul, and he was unable to get any divine guidance. In his desperation, Saul disguised himself and sought out the Witch of Endor.

In his desperation, Saul disguised himself and sought out the Witch of Endor. The Witch of Endor was known for her ability to communicate with the dead, which was considered a form of witchcraft and was explicitly forbidden by the Hebrew Bible. When Saul requested her assistance in summoning Samuel, she was initially hesitant due to the potential consequences.

The Pagan King

Northern Europe. 13th century. Last pagan settlement near the Baltic Sea. The evil and cynical warrior crusader Max von Buxhoveden is trying to destroy the pagan beliefs of the people by spreading lies and fostering dissent. Old king of the last free pagan lands is on his deathbed and without an heir to take his place. Max wants to take over the throne and reign over old king’s tribe. Unexpectedly, with his dying breath the King passes on his ring to his nephew Namejs. The youngster, who grew up amongst pagan priests and studied ancient wisdoms, now has to defend his people. Will he be able to unravel the secret of the Ring and gain its power?

However, Saul assured her that she would not be punished, and she agreed to perform the séance. During the séance, the Witch of Endor succeeded in summoning Samuel's spirit, who appeared and spoke to Saul. Samuel gave a prophecy of the impending defeat of Saul and his sons in battle, indicating that God had turned away from Saul and chosen David as the future king of Israel. The story of the Witch of Endor has long fascinated biblical scholars and readers due to its supernatural elements. It raises questions about the reality of witchcraft and the afterlife. Some interpretations suggest that the spirit summoned by the witch was not actually Samuel but a demonic impersonation. The character of the Witch of Endor serves as a cautionary figure in the biblical narrative, highlighting the dangers of seeking forbidden supernatural powers and going against God's will. The story underscores the importance of faith and trust in God's guidance rather than turning to illicit means for answers. Overall, the Witch of Endor is a noteworthy character in biblical literature, known for her role in facilitating a supernatural encounter and delivering a prophetic message to King Saul. Her story serves as a reminder of the consequences of straying from God's commandments and seeking forbidden knowledge..
